What marks the end of the third stage of labor?

  • A. Full cervical dilation
  • B. Expulsion of the placenta and membranes
  • C. Birth of the infant
  • D. Engagement of the head
Correct Answer: B

Rationale: The third stage of labor extends from the birth of the infant until the placenta is detached and expelled.
